EDMONTON
An Alberta Energy and Utilities Board (AEUB) hearing began Oct. 17 to assess whether appellants Epcor and Atco should proceed with a proposed 170 megawatt gas turbine expansion known as Rossdale Unit 11 on its existing power plant site in Edmonton.
Epcor hopes the hearing will help resolve problems between itself and local Aboriginal people. This even though AEUB has ruled a nearby cemetery of concern to some Native people is "not an issue" in making its determination, according to Epcor archeologist Barney Reeves.
